Ensuring a glowing skin appearance requires more than just good genes—it requires a dedicated skin maintenance practice. The skin, being our most expansive organ, it is subject to various atmospheric pollutants, UV rays, and multiple elements that affect its condition. An everyday practice featuring cleansing, moisturizing, treatment masks, concentrated treatments, and beauty oils is key to ensuring skin that remains youthful and resilient.

Daily cleansing is the basis of maintaining clear skin. During daily activities, pores collect impurities, oil, and pollutants, that, when ignored, may cause blemishes, dullness, and other concerns. Proper washing gets rid of these impurities, ensuring a fresh facial area. Yet, one must to use a mild face wash suited for individual concerns to avoid dehydration. Cleansers with strong chemicals can deplete the skin’s protective barrier, leading to sensitivity. Individuals prone to irritation should opt for dermatologist-recommended options. People prone to shine benefit from gel-based washes that regulate oil without overcompensating. Nourishing face washes suit dry skin, ensuring moisture retention.

After washing, hydration becomes essential for protecting the skin. Moisturizers help to maintain skin softness, preventing flakiness or sensitivity. Regardless of skin condition, moisturization is beneficial. People dealing with acne can opt for lightweight moisturizers that nourish while allowing the skin to breathe. Parched complexions, a deeply Bakuchiol hydrating formula helps sustain comfort. Those with both oily and dry areas demands balanced hydration to maintain equilibrium. Over time, hydration-focused care maintains soft, radiant texture.

Beauty oils are highly recommended for their ability to deeply nourish. Compared to lotions and creams, beauty oils penetrate deeper to provide long-lasting hydration. Oils like rosehip oil, packed with antioxidants, improve skin elasticity. For those with oily skin, fast-absorbing oils like jojoba regulate oil production. Dry or mature skin types see the most results with richer oils including marula, which restore moisture. Incorporating a facial oil as a final step helps lock in hydration, giving improved skin texture.
